Heim  >  Artikel  >  Java  >  Java Git: Entdecken Sie die Geheimnisse der Versionskontrolle und verwalten Sie Codeänderungen einfach

Java Git: Entdecken Sie die Geheimnisse der Versionskontrolle und verwalten Sie Codeänderungen einfach

王林
王林nach vorne
2024-02-20 08:41:45858Durchsuche

Java Git:揭秘版本控制的奥秘,轻松管理代码变更

Was ist Git?

git ist ein verteiltes Versionskontrollsystem, was bedeutet, dass jeder Entwickler eine vollständige Kopie der Codebasis auf seinem Computer hat. Dies ist anders als bei einem zentralisierten Versionskontrollsystem (wie Subversion), bei dem es nur eine zentrale Kopie der Codebasis gibt. Einer der Hauptvorteile eines verteilten Versionskontrollsystems besteht darin, dass Entwickler offline arbeiten und dennoch Änderungen festschreiben können, wenn das zentrale Code-Repository nicht verfügbar ist.

Warum Git verwenden?

Die Verwendung von Git bietet viele Vorteile, darunter:

  • Codeänderungen verfolgen: Git hilft Ihnen, alle Änderungen in Ihrem Code zu verfolgen, sodass Sie problemlos zu einer früheren Version zurückkehren oder verschiedene Versionen vergleichen können.
  • Gemeinsame Entwicklung: Git erleichtert mehreren Entwicklern die Zusammenarbeit an Projekten. Sie können Ihre Codeänderungen in ein Remote-Code-Repository übertragen, sodass andere Entwickler Ihre Änderungen abrufen und in ihren Code integrieren können.
  • Schützen Sie Ihre Codebasis: Git kann Ihnen dabei helfen, Ihre Codebasis vor Datenverlust oder Beschädigung zu schützen. Sie können Backups erstellen, damit Ihr Code im Katastrophenfall wiederhergestellt werden kann.

Wie verwende ich Git?

Um Git verwenden zu können, müssen Sie Git zunächst auf Ihrem Computer installieren. Auf der Git-Website finden Sie Installationsprogramme für verschiedene Betriebssysteme.

Nach der Installation von Git können Sie ein neues Git-Repository initialisieren. Mit dem folgenden Befehl können Sie ein neues Git-Repository im aktuellen Verzeichnis erstellen:

git init

Dadurch wird ein verstecktes Verzeichnis mit dem Namen .git unter dem aktuellen Verzeichnis erstellt. Dieses Verzeichnis enthält alle Git-Metadaten, einschließlich des Verlaufs, der Zweige und Tags des Repositorys.

Sie können jetzt Dateien zu Ihrem Git-Repository hinzufügen. Mit dem folgenden Befehl können Sie Dateien zum Staging-Bereich hinzufügen:

git add

Der Bereitstellungsbereich ist eine Sammlung von Dateien, die zur Übermittlung bereitstehen. Mit dem folgenden Befehl können Sie Dateien im Staging-Bereich übermitteln:

git commit -m "提交消息"

Die Commit-Nachricht ist eine kurze Beschreibung, in der die von Ihnen vorgenommenen Änderungen erläutert werden.

Sie können Ihre Änderungen jetzt in das Remote-Repository übertragen. Sie können Ihre Änderungen mit dem folgenden Befehl in das Remote-Repository auf GitHub übertragen:

git push origin master

Dadurch werden Ihre Änderungen in den Zweig mit dem Namen origin 的远程代码库中的 master übertragen.

Git-Befehle

Git verfügt über viele Befehle, die Ihnen bei der Verwaltung Ihrer Codebasis helfen können. Hier sind einige der am häufigsten verwendeten Git-Befehle:

  • git init: Initialisieren Sie ein neues Git-Repository.
  • git add: Dateien zum Staging-Bereich hinzufügen.
  • git commit: Senden Sie die Dateien im Staging-Bereich.
  • git push: Übertragen Sie Ihre Änderungen in das Remote-Repository.
  • git pull: Änderungen aus dem Remote-Repository ziehen.
  • Git-Zweig: Alle Zweige auflisten.
  • git checkout: Wechseln Sie zu einer anderen Filiale.
  • git merge: Zwei Zweige zusammenführen.
  • git diff: Vergleichen Sie zwei Versionen einer Datei.
  • Git-Protokoll: Zeigt den Verlauf der Codebasis an.

Git-Ressourcen

Es gibt viele Ressourcen, die Ihnen beim Lernen und der Verwendung von Git helfen. Hier sind einige der beliebtesten Ressourcen:

  • Offizielle Git-Website
  • Git-Tutorial
  • Git-Bücher
  • Git-Community

Git-Codebeispiele

Hier ist ein einfaches Git-Codebeispiel, das zeigt, wie Sie mit Git Codeänderungen verfolgen und Änderungen festschreiben:

# 初始化一个新的 Git 仓库
git init

# 将文件添加到暂存区
git add hello.py

# 提交暂存区中的文件
git commit -m "添加 hello.py 文件"

# 将您的更改推送到远程代码库
git push origin master

Dieser Code erstellt eine neue Datei mit dem Namen hello.py, fügt sie dem Git-Repository hinzu, schreibt die Änderungen fest und überträgt die Änderungen dann an das Remote-Repository.

Fazit

Git ist ein leistungsstarkes Tool, das Ihnen bei der Verwaltung Ihrer Codebasis helfen kann. Es ist leicht zu erlernen und zu verwenden, selbst für Entwickler, die noch keine Erfahrung mit der Versionskontrolle haben. Mit Git können Sie Codeänderungen verfolgen, zusammenarbeiten und Ihre Codebasis schützen.

Das obige ist der detaillierte Inhalt vonJava Git: Entdecken Sie die Geheimnisse der Versionskontrolle und verwalten Sie Codeänderungen einfach.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Dieser Artikel ist reproduziert unter:lsjlt.com. Bei Verstößen wenden Sie sich bitte an admin@php.cn löschen